Partage
  • Partager sur Facebook
  • Partager sur Twitter

Allumer moto en rfid avec arduino

    4 janvier 2021 à 2:14:02

    Bonjour à toutes et à tous,

    je cherche partout sur internet un moyen avec un lecteur rfid d’arduino d’allumer ma moto. Il faudrais faire en sorte que quand le bon badge soit lu la moto s’allume mais quand il y a le mauvais badge une led rouge s’allume. Je ne sais pas du tout quoi faire comme schema, s’il il faut mettre un relais ou un transistor et je n’y connais rien du tout en code. Pouvez-vous m’aider à faire mon schéma et mon code ?

    Merci beaucoup pour votre aide !

    • Partager sur Facebook
    • Partager sur Twitter

    Julien Bonzi

      4 janvier 2021 à 8:42:17

      Hello, ça fait quand même pas mal de boulot si tu n'y connais rien en code. Quand tu dis "allumer", c'est juste mettre le contact ou lancer aussi le démarreur ? Est-ce que c'est a pour but d'ajouter une sécurité antivol ?

      Dans tous les cas il faut penser sécurité et usage au quotidien, en conservant un moyen de désactiver rapidement ton montage: faudrait pas que ta moto soit bloquée parce que ton lecteur est en panne (ça arrive toujours quand on est pressé), ou que ton Arduino coupe/allume intempestivement ta moto pendant que tu roules.
      • Partager sur Facebook
      • Partager sur Twitter
      "On ne remplace pas des plombs sautés avant de savoir pourquoi ils ont sauté." 2001 l'odyssée de l'espace, Arthur C. Clarke
        4 janvier 2021 à 23:42:06

        Un Arduino sur une moto :o ? La référence dans le monde de l'Arduino pour ce que tu veux faire c'est le module RC522 RFID : voici un tutoriel simple pour le mettre en œuvre : https://lastminuteengineers.com/how-rfid-works-rc522-arduino-tutorial/ mais à vrai dire moi je l'utilise pour identifier des poules dans un poulailler à savoir si elles sont à l'intérieur ou non ?

        Bref, une moto c'est pas un poulailler ! C'est beaucoup plus complexe que ça à mettre en œuvre sur une moto.

        1 : La question de faisabilité : sur beaucoup de moto maintenant comme sur les voitures l'ensemble de l'électronique est relié par un bus appelé bus CAN (Pour Controler Area Network) : c'est un bus série qui permet à l'électronique de la moto de communiquer. Il te faudrait identifier grâce à du matériel CAN vers USB la séquence binaire de démarrage qui relie le démarrage de ta moto et la clef. Il y a peu de chance que tu y arrives : la séquence de démarrage doit présenter des sécurités softwares lié au hardware ou des variantes à chaque démarrage.

        2 : La question de la sécurité : Pourquoi tu ne pourrais pas ? Tu peux comprendre que pour l'antivol c'est beaucoup plus complexe que ça ! Sinon je pourrais prendre n'importe quel moto dans la rue si j'ai un ordinateur et le câble CAN. Imaginons que même par miracle même si tu y arrives : Il faudrait à minima : chiffrer ta puce et mettre par exemple un system de Rolling Code et de vérification d'intégrité etc ... pour sécuriser ta puce RFID (à MINIMA) : pour éviter le vol de ta clef et par extension de ta moto.

        Bref ce que tu souhaites faire est très difficile voir impossible pour moi : si tu n'es pas le constructeur de la moto ou l'ingénieur software de la moto.

        Néanmoins je t'invite à effectuer le premier tutoriel afin de comprendre le fonctionnement du RFID.

        Bon courage.

        Kasimashi.

        -
        Edité par Kasimashi 4 janvier 2021 à 23:44:04

        • Partager sur Facebook
        • Partager sur Twitter
          10 janvier 2021 à 18:53:42

          Salut ! 
          je ne cherche pas spécialement à y faire pour de la sécurité je cherche juste à allumer le contact et y r’ajouter en plus de la clé comme y mettre à côté comme ça si il y a un problème avec l’arduino la clé peut toujours être la. Et ma moto n’a pas de démarreur électrique elle s’allume au kick donc il n’y a pas de software dedans donc pas de sécurité spéciale je pense. Ma moto date de 2002 et les sécurités dans les 50cc étaient très faible à cette époque

          • Partager sur Facebook
          • Partager sur Twitter

          Julien Bonzi

            12 janvier 2021 à 14:10:32

            Sur le papier (je suis pas un expert) il suffirait d'utiliser l'arduino pour piloter des relais qui simuleraient l'action de ton contacteur à clef. Par sécurité il faudrait que ton coupe-circuit au guidon coupe aussi l'arduino (et les relais branchés dessus). Cela dit faut quand-même débloquer le Neiman, donc mettre la clef, non ?
            • Partager sur Facebook
            • Partager sur Twitter
            "On ne remplace pas des plombs sautés avant de savoir pourquoi ils ont sauté." 2001 l'odyssée de l'espace, Arthur C. Clarke
              13 janvier 2021 à 15:26:13

              Je ne sais pas du tout si il faudrais débloquer le neiman je ne me suis pas du tout posé la question. Et quand tu dis qu’il faudrais couper l’arduino dans ce cas je ne pourrais plus l’utiliser s.il est éteint non ?
              • Partager sur Facebook
              • Partager sur Twitter

              Julien Bonzi

                13 janvier 2021 à 15:53:00

                Le neiman reste le point noir : vu qu'il faut débloquer le guidon avec la clef, et qu'il suffit de tourner cette clef d'un cran de plus pour avoir le contact, quel intérêt d'ajouter un arduino ?

                Sinon l'idée du coupe circuit, c'est histoire de disposer d'un arrêt d'urgence en cas de bug (c'est des choses qui arrivent, surtout quand on est débutant).
                • Partager sur Facebook
                • Partager sur Twitter
                "On ne remplace pas des plombs sautés avant de savoir pourquoi ils ont sauté." 2001 l'odyssée de l'espace, Arthur C. Clarke

                Allumer moto en rfid avec arduino

                ×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
                • Editeur
                • Markdown